Description

Since the Dawn of Time humankind has expressed itself through the arts - from the earliest cave paintings through to blockbuster movies. Dance, sculpture, music and theatre have informed religious ritual, cultural expression and entertainment throughout history. HP Lovecraft and others developed the traditional literary ghost tale into a new format - Cosmic Horror. Since his writings, this new Mythos has been developed and expanded by numerous authors.

Here, members of the Innsmouth Writing Circle bring you new tales of the weird and the Lovecraftian, all based on the theme of the Arts.

From doomed musicians, to magical paintings, from lost Shakespeare plays to unworldly sculptures. Thirteen tales that may well change your perspective on Art and Creation...
